Manipur Governor Anusuiya Uikey holds high-level meet to resolve DMU crisis

Manipur Governor Anusuiya Uikey convened a meeting with Education Minister Th Basantakumar Singh, chief secretary, Manipur, Vineet Joshi and Education Commissioner H Gyan Prakash ar Raj Bhavan on Tuesday and discussed the issues pertaining to the administration and development of Dhanamanjuri University.

During the meeting, the Governor enquired about the issues faced by the students in the absence of a regular vice chancellor and segistrar, stated a release from the Governor’s Secretariat. She also enquired about the status of joining the teaching and non-teaching staff, it stated.

Briefing the Governor, Education Minister, Th Basantakumar informed her that the results of the same will be declared soon. He also assured that steps for nomination of a UGC member for the appointment process of a new VC will soon be initiated, it mentioned.

While, Chief Secretary told the Governor that the process for recruitment of a new Vice Chancellor is in progress and advertisement for the same will be issued shortly, it stated. Arrangement for appointment of a new Registrar is on, he added.

Uikey also urged them to expedite ways to sort out all issues pertaining to the students and teaching community, it asserted. She further asked them to expedite the process of new recruitment including the VC, it stated.

She then enquired about the status of students of various colleges living in relief camps and asked the Chief Secretary to take up necessary steps for them, it stated.

The Governor also enquired about the implementation of NEP-2020 to the universities and colleges in the State and directed the officials to organize regular meetings of all central, state and private universities in the State at Raj Bhavan, it mentioned.

Meanwhile, Major General Ravroop Singh, IGAR (South) also called on Governor Anusuiya Uikey at Raj Bhavan and briefed her about the prevailing security situation in the State, it stated.

He informed her that Assam Rifles is helping the administration in controlling the situation by deploying its personnel to vulnerable areas including the far flung interior areas of Jiribam district, it noted.

The force is prepared to face any eventuality at any point in time so that peace prevails anywhere in the State, he maintained. Governor Uikey appreciated their efforts and asked them to continue the same for the restoration of peace and normalcy in the state, the release added.
